Skip to content

Instantly share code, notes, and snippets.

@jglick
Created August 4, 2015 16:09
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save jglick/6d6831f7f02a22ababff to your computer and use it in GitHub Desktop.
Save jglick/6d6831f7f02a22ababff to your computer and use it in GitHub Desktop.
"AtmostOneTaskExecutor[hudson.model.Queue$1@1f16ef23] [#6]":
waiting for ownable synchronizer 0x00000007d7f92fd8, (a java.util.concurrent.locks.ReentrantReadWriteLock$NonfairSync),
which is held by "Executing basics(org.jenkinci.plugins.mock_slave.MockSlaveTest)"
"Executing basics(org.jenkinci.plugins.mock_slave.MockSlaveTest)":
waiting for ownable synchronizer 0x0000000749a12190, (a java.util.concurrent.locks.ReentrantLock$NonfairSync),
which is held by "AtmostOneTaskExecutor[hudson.model.Queue$1@1f16ef23] [#6]"
"AtmostOneTaskExecutor[hudson.model.Queue$1@1f16ef23] [#6]":
at sun.misc.Unsafe.park(Native Method)
- parking to wait for <0x00000007d7f92fd8> (a java.util.concurrent.locks.ReentrantReadWriteLock$NonfairSync)
at java.util.concurrent.locks.LockSupport.park(LockSupport.java:186)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.parkAndCheckInterrupt(AbstractQueuedSynchronizer.java:834)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.doAcquireShared(AbstractQueuedSynchronizer.java:964)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.acquireShared(AbstractQueuedSynchronizer.java:1282)
at java.util.concurrent.locks.ReentrantReadWriteLock$ReadLock.lock(ReentrantReadWriteLock.java:731)
at hudson.model.Executor.isParking(Executor.java:609)
at hudson.model.Queue.maintain(Queue.java:1277)
at hudson.model.Queue$1.call(Queue.java:334)
at hudson.model.Queue$1.call(Queue.java:331)
at jenkins.util.AtmostOneTaskExecutor$1.call(AtmostOneTaskExecutor.java:101)
at jenkins.util.AtmostOneTaskExecutor$1.call(AtmostOneTaskExecutor.java:91)
at java.util.concurrent.FutureTask.run(FutureTask.java:262)
at hudson.remoting.AtmostOneThreadExecutor$Worker.run(AtmostOneThreadExecutor.java:110)
at java.lang.Thread.run(Thread.java:745)
"Executing basics(org.jenkinci.plugins.mock_slave.MockSlaveTest)":
at sun.misc.Unsafe.park(Native Method)
- parking to wait for <0x0000000749a12190> (a java.util.concurrent.locks.ReentrantLock$NonfairSync)
at java.util.concurrent.locks.LockSupport.park(LockSupport.java:186)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.parkAndCheckInterrupt(AbstractQueuedSynchronizer.java:834)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.acquireQueued(AbstractQueuedSynchronizer.java:867)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.acquire(AbstractQueuedSynchronizer.java:1197)
at java.util.concurrent.locks.ReentrantLock$NonfairSync.lock(ReentrantLock.java:214)
at java.util.concurrent.locks.ReentrantLock.lock(ReentrantLock.java:290)
at hudson.model.Queue._withLock(Queue.java:1205)
at hudson.model.Queue.withLock(Queue.java:1143)
at hudson.model.Computer.removeExecutor(Computer.java:977)
at hudson.model.Executor.interrupt(Executor.java:187)
at hudson.model.Executor.interrupt(Executor.java:164)
at hudson.model.Executor.interruptForShutdown(Executor.java:149)
at hudson.model.Computer.interrupt(Computer.java:1014)
at jenkins.model.Jenkins.cleanUp(Jenkins.java:2769)
at org.jvnet.hudson.test.JenkinsRule.after(JenkinsRule.java:460)
at …
@jglick
Copy link
Author

jglick commented Aug 4, 2015

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ment